My wife and I just finished watching The Day of The Doctor, the 50th anniversary special episode of Doctor Who. She, a fan of the series since it was rebooted after a long hiatus, and I, an old school fan since the days of Jon Pertwee (3rd Doctor).

The BBC did a great job creating a fun episode that drew on many of the plot lines from the revived series, while liberally dusting it with fan service for old coots like myself. As an added bonus, the next Doctor was given a (sort of) cameo, and a new purpose was set before the character of The Doctor. The final shot in the episode, as well as the credits, hit me right in the Fan Feels.

Additionally, there was an unannounced cameo that, for the life of me, I have no idea how they kept secret (but, this is the same team that kept Paul McGann's web-only minisode a secret, so I should not be surprised).
